Amala Paul To Play Banarasi Girl In Ajay Devgn's 'Bholaa'

Many actresses from South India have written success stories in Hindi films. With their acting and style, they achieved a long fan following. Now another actress is making her journey from South to Mumbai. This is Amala Paul, a well-known actress of South films, who will be seen in an important role in Ajay Devgn's film Bholaa. Ajay is shooting for the film in Varanasi. Amala has reached Varanasi for shooting, from where her picture has come out.
In the picture of Amala's shoot that has come to the fore, she is seen driving a scooty. A purple helmet is worn on the head. According to sources close to the film, Amala is playing the character of a Banarasi girl in 'Bholaa'. So far only this information has come out. Amala is a very famous actress of South Indian cinema. She has done a lot of work in Tamil, Telugu and Malayalam languages. Bholaa is her Hindi debut. Amala's debut in films may be from Bholaa, but Amala has started her innings in Hindi OTT. He played a character in Voot's series 'Ranjish Hi Sahi'. Abhishek Bachchan is also in Varanasi for the shooting of Bholaa. This star cast will shoot in Varanasi for a week.
Bholaa is being directed by Ajay Devgn himself. Earlier, he directed Runway 34. A few days ago the teaser of Bholaa was released, in which Ajay Devgn's character was introduced. Bholaa, locked inside the jail, was shown reciting the Gita and applying ashes on his forehead. The teaser was well-liked. Tabu will also be seen in an important role in the film.
